Here is the Fresh Cucumber Salsa recipe:

(All ingredients are fresh – just bought or pulled from the garden)

  • 5 large tomatoes (diced into small pieces)
  • 1 bunch of green onions (diced)
  • 3 mini sweet peppers (diced)
  • 1/3 cucumber (diced)
  • 1/2 red onion (diced)
  • 2 tbsp of chopped fresh cilantro

Mix all ingredients together and serve with fresh chips, or as a side to any meal.
